Trump's backing fails to sway some voters in South Carolina runoff

Several Trump supporters at a rally in Myrtle Beach remain undecided about backing Senate candidate Darline Graham in Tuesday's GOP runoff. They cited her debate performance, particularly her comment that national security is not her strength. The race pits Graham against five-term Representative Ralph Norman.
